Stats & Training
The stat bars tell the story: Speed carries everything and HP's dead weight. But this Mole Pokemon still yields 1 Speed EV per fight on a medium-fast 1M XP curve.
Its skin is very thin. If it is exposed to light, its blood heats up, causing it to grow weak.
If a DIGLETT digs through a field, it leaves the soil perfectly tilled and ideal for planting crops.
Diglett Weakness
Type-wise, Diglett takes extra damage from Water, Grass, and Ice. Electric moves do nothing thanks to a full immunity. Not too many gaps in the chart, 3 weaknesses to account for.
| Damage | Types |
|---|---|
| 2x (Weak) | Water, Grass, Ice |
| 0.5x (Resist) | Poison, Rock |
| 0x (Immune) | Electric |

HeartGold & SoulSilver Evolution
Diglett is the base form in a two-stage line leading to Dugtrio. Check the evolution method below. A massive partner pool for breeding via one egg group. Eggs are average hatch time. Evolving adds up to 160 stat points total. View every chain in the Evolution Chart.

Breeding
Breed Diglett easily with 131 breeding partners from the Ground egg group. Pass egg moves like Ancient Power, Astonish, Beat Up and 7 more to offspring.
